Most newer homes are being built with all hardwood floors and this trend has spurred another trend in the floor care industry. Vacuum cleaner manufactures are turning their R&D resources to appliances geared to cleaning hardwood floors.
Hardwood flooring doesn’t require the strong agitation of a motorized brushroll to remove dirt like carpeting does. With carpet, dirt and debris becomes trapped in the carpet pile and must be loosened a lifted in order to suck it into the vacuum cleaner.
Whereas with hardwood flooring the dirt and debris remains on the surface. Gentle agitation helps loosen sticky dirt a to be sucked up but the problem is that most vacuums designed for carpet tend to push along any debris such as dog or cat food and pet hair. The spinning brushroll that works great on carpet flings the debris all over the room when your vacuuming hardwood flooring.
A Canister Vacuum is Still a Great Option for Hardwood Floors and Pet Hair!
For over half a century a good old canister vacuum worked just fine on hardwood floors with just a floor nozzle with some bristles on it. The forward and backward motion whisks the clingy dust lose to be sucked into the nozzle.
When you encounter pet hair or large debris such as pet food you simply rock the floor brush back a little to allow space for the debris to enter the vacuum nozzle. This technique works great and allows you to safely and effectively clean your hardwood floors. What could be simpler?
A Simpler Way to Vacuum Pet Hair and Debris from Hardwood Floors!
And just when we thought there was nothing left to invented, floor-care engineers have up with a clever design concept that virtually eliminates all but the most basic skill to operate a vacuum cleaner.
They figured out that using a soft cushy roller with some rows of bristles will roll over the larger debris, embracing it until its transferred under the suction port instead of flinging it all over the house. It works – and works great!

Shark Rocket Complete w/ DuoClean HV382
This well-designed corded stick vacuum offers a revolutionary feature designed especially for cleaning Hardwood Floors.
It’s called “DuoClean” because it utilizes (2) spinning rollers instead of just one.
The Front Roller is soft or spongy and when it encounters a large chunk of dirt or debris such as pet food it rolls over it, embedding it while rotating it under the suction port before it gets to the spinning brushroll. The result is the debris gets sucked up instead of getting flung all over the floor.
The Rear Roller does its job of loosening sticky dirt and pet hair from hardwood floors or carpet just like a conventional upright vacuum.
This clever design has solved the age-old problem of vacuuming hardwood floors.
The Shark Rocket Complete w/ DuoClean HV382 easily converts to a hand vacuum for cleaning furniture and stairs giving it excellent versatility.
